Retrieve $list item into longstring

Most Sirius $functions have been deprecated in favor of Object Oriented methods. The OO equivalent for the $ListInf_Lstr function is the Item (Stringlist function).

This function returns the current contents of a specified $list item as a longstring.

The $ListInf_Lstr function accepts two arguments and returns a longstring result.

The first argument is a $list identifier. This is a required argument.

The second argument is the number of the item in the $list. This is a required argument.

Syntax

<section begin="syntax" />%result = $ListInf_Lstr(list_identifier, item_num) <section end="syntax" />

$ListInf_Lstr Function

%result is a string that contains the contents of the indicated $list item.

$ListInf_Lstr works almost exactly like $ListInf except:

  • It returns a longstring result so will cause request cancellation if the target %variable is not big enough to hold the result.
  • It cancels the request on any errors such as invalid $list identifier or invalid $list item number.
  • It does not have item position and length arguments (arguments 3 and 4 in $ListInf).

$ListInf_Lstr is available in Sirius Mods Version 6.2 and later.
